Walt Disney (DIS) Ascends While Market Falls: Some Facts to Note

Walt Disney (DIS - Free Report) ended the recent trading session at $90.71, demonstrating a +0.47% swing from the preceding day's closing price. This move outpaced the S&P 500's daily loss of 0.57%. Meanwhile, the Dow gained 0.07%, and the Nasdaq, a tech-heavy index, lost 1.64%.

Heading into today, shares of the entertainment company had lost 1.87% over the past month, lagging the Consumer Discretionary sector's gain of 3.69% and the S&P 500's gain of 4% in that time.

The investment community will be closely monitoring the performance of Walt Disney in its forthcoming earnings report. It is anticipated that the company will report an EPS of $1.01, marking a 2.02% rise compared to the same quarter of the previous year. Meanwhile, the Zacks Consensus Estimate for revenue is projecting net sales of $23.54 billion, up 0.11% from the year-ago period.

For the annual period, the Zacks Consensus Estimates anticipate earnings of $4.38 per share and a revenue of $91.99 billion, signifying shifts of +16.49% and +3.48%, respectively, from the last year.

Over the past month, the Zacks Consensus EPS estimate has shifted 0.07% upward. Walt Disney is holding a Zacks Rank of #3 (Hold) right now.

In terms of valuation, Walt Disney is presently being traded at a Forward P/E ratio of 20.62. This indicates a premium in contrast to its industry's Forward P/E of 15.36.

It's also important to note that DIS currently trades at a PEG ratio of 1.67. The PEG ratio is akin to the commonly utilized P/E ratio, but this measure also incorporates the company's anticipated earnings growth rate. The average PEG ratio for the Media Conglomerates industry stood at 1.7 at the close of the market yesterday.
